2707, NSW · Postcode
How people move — recent moves within Australia and arrivals from overseas.
Changing patterns of movement have shaped postcode 2707, where more people have moved into the area since 2011. While the proportion of new overseas arrivals has dropped, the region now sees a higher share of people arriving from abroad than the national figure.
People who moved in the last five years.
About 28.2% of residents moved here in the last five years, which is far below the New South Wales figure of 39.9%. This is lower than most other areas, though the number has risen 3.7 percentage points since 2011.

Overseas-born residents who arrived recently.
Recent overseas arrivals make up 19.4% of the population, which is well above the Australian figure of 14.5%. This is much higher than most areas, despite the proportion falling 4.2 percentage points since 2011.
